What does SIMM stand for?

Single Inline Memory Module, used to refer to memory chips prior to the introduction of Dual Inline Memory Module.

What does the acronym 'SIMM' stand for?

SIMM stands for "Single In-line Memory Module". It is a type of random access memory that was used in computers in the early 1980's to the late 1990's.
